Problem

Conventional toilet systems require significant water for flushing and cleaning, which can be inefficient and impractical in low-water environments, and they often struggle with odor control and effective waste disposal, especially in locations below the sewer elevation.

Innovation Solution

A waterless self-cleaning toilet system utilizing a side-opening sleeve valve and a pig cleaning technology, where a pressurized fluid system pushes a cylindrical pig through the piping to isolate and dispose of waste without the need for flush water, significantly reducing water usage and incorporating a venting system for odor management.

Solution Approach 1:

The patent employs a pigging system that uses pressurized fluid (pneumatic/hydraulic principle) to push a cylindrical pig through the piping system. The pig isolates and transports waste material from the toilet bowl through the piping to the sewer system without requiring traditional flush water volumes, achieving efficient waste disposal with minimal water consumption.

Solution Approach 1:

The side-opening valve employs a nested structure where an inner barrel is disposed within an outer barrel. The inner barrel can rotate relative to the outer barrel to align or misalign their respective openings, providing effective waste isolation through a compact nested configuration rather than a complex multi-component mechanism.

Function Achieved in This Case

The system achieves at least 90% reduction in water usage, ensures sanitary operation, and allows for placement in low-elevation areas by using pressurized fluid to push waste uphill, while maintaining low odor levels through efficient waste disposal and air venting.

AI summary

A side-opening sleeve valve having an inner barrel with a shaped opening through its cylindrical wall having a longer size along the axis of the inner barrel, and a co-annular outer barrel having shaped opening through its cylindrical wall having a longer size along the axis of the outer barrel. The inner barrel is rotatable relative to the outer barrel between a first open position where the shaped openings overlap to form a side opening into the sleeve valve, and a second closed position where the shaped openings do not overlap. The side opening has an effective axial opening size and an effective lateral opening size in a ratio of at least about 2:1. The side-opening valve is useful with water-less toilet that can empty into the side-opening valve when opened, and when closed, a pigging fluid flush system pushes the waste in the side-opening valve to a sewage system.
